Frequently Asked Questions

What is the main difference between census and sampling?

A census collects data from every member of a population, while sampling involves selecting a subset of the population to study, which is more practical and cost-effective.

How does cluster sampling work?

Cluster sampling involves dividing the population into clusters, randomly selecting some of these clusters, and then studying all members within the selected clusters.

What is the purpose of one-stage cluster sampling?

One-stage cluster sampling simplifies data collection by selecting entire clusters at once, making it easier to manage and more feasible when studying large populations.

How does purposive sampling differ from random selection?

Purposive sampling involves non-random selection based on specific characteristics, while random selection ensures every member of the population has an equal chance of being included.
